person having shoulders massagedMassage therapy at Commonwealth Chiropractic Center of Reston PC goes far beyond relaxation to address the root causes of pain and movement dysfunction. Under the skilled hands of Peter Sherry, our specialized Sports Massage Therapist, each session targets specific issues affecting your comfort and performance. Peter’s approach focuses on releasing muscle tension, breaking up adhesions, and reducing pain and stiffness that may be limiting your activities.

These therapeutic benefits extend to improved circulation, allowing your muscles to work more efficiently during daily activities and athletic pursuits. Many patients also report reduced stress and anxiety, along with improved sleep quality—benefits that enhance overall well-being beyond the physical improvements.

Specialized Techniques for Optimal Results

Unlike typical spa massages, our therapeutic approach emphasizes clinical effectiveness over ambiance. Peter combines Swedish massage foundations with specialized Deep Tissue and Sports Massage techniques to address your specific concerns. His advanced training in Active Isolated Stretching (AIS) provides additional tools to improve flexibility and function, particularly beneficial for athletic performance and injury recovery.

Peter also brings valuable expertise in gait analysis for runners, helping identify and correct movement patterns that may be causing pain or limiting performance. This comprehensive skill set allows him to customize each session to your unique needs, whether you’re recovering from injury, preparing for competition, or seeking relief from chronic tension.

What to Expect During Your Session

Preparing for your massage therapy appointment is simple—just wear loose-fitting athletic attire or bring shorts to change into for your session. If you’re a runner seeking gait analysis or specific help with running-related issues, bring your current running shoes and inserts for evaluation.

During your initial visit, Peter will discuss your health history, current concerns, and goals for treatment before customizing your session. Each appointment can include massage therapy, flexibility exercises, or a combination of both, depending on your needs. Unlike spa environments with predetermined music or scents, you’re welcome to select music that helps you feel comfortable during your treatment.
